Mohammad Ganj is a small village of 121 hectares in Dungla Tehsil in Chittorgarh district in the State of Rajasthan, India.[2] The village is administrated by a sarpanch who is elected representative of the village by the local elections. Mohammad Ganj depends on Kapasan, the nearest town for all major economic activities.[3] The village has government-provided water facilities that include Two taps, One Well supply, which is 11.00% of the total supply, Two tanks, Two tubewells, and One handpump. The villagers also acquire water from some of the natural water sources - Two rivers, Two canals and Two springs. Mohammad Ganj is also surrounded by Two lakes. The population of the village depends on the source of drinking water during summer on Well. Mohammad Ganj's pin code is 312024[4], and village code is 03636900. The area of Mohammad Ganj is segregated as 13 hectares irrigated area, 16 hectares unirrigated, the 52 hectare area under culturable waste (including gauchar and groves), and remaining 40 hectare area not available for cultivation.

Mohammad Ganj has Two banks and Two credit societies for the regulation of economic activity. The village is also equipped with Two recreational centers.

The village has an uninterrupted 24 hours electric supply from a power grid.

Demographics

Mohammad Ganj is a census village in the district of Chittorgarh, Rajasthan. The village has a total population of 257 and has total administration over 51 houses which are connected to supplies basic amenities like water and sewerage.

  • Mohammad Ganj has 44 children, 29 boys and 15 girls.
  • Scheduled caste counts for 255 (99.22%) males constitute 141 (54.86%) of the population and females 114 (44.36%).
  • Scheduled tribe counts for 2 (0.78%) males constitute 2 (0.78%) of the population and females 0 (0.0%).

Educational institutions

As per the census 2011 report, 125 people are literate in Mohammad Ganj out of which 88 are males and 37 are females.

Mohammad Ganj has the following educational facilities:

  • 1 Education facility
  • 1 Primary school
  • 3 Colleges in the nearby range

Employment

According to a census 2011 report, 164 people of the total population are employed. The workforce is 86 male, 78 female with 110 (67.07%) of all workers being employed full-time, this includes 69 males and 41 females. 65 males and 35 females are considered as the main cultivators with the help of 1 male and 5 female agricultural labor. 54 people are reported to work for a marginal period of time in the year.

They depend on the agricultural markets (Mandi) of the nearby towns of Kapasan and Chittorgarh to sell agricultural produce and make their living.
